Critique #3!

Anderbo is an online journal that specializes in fiction, poetry, "fact," and photography. It provides a platform for artists to present their work and it does an good job doing so. The site provides a simple, clean environment with an effective, if simple, presentation. It doesn't provide too much, but it does not need to.
As for using the electronic format effectively, it does not seem to exploit its full potential. As is, it is merely a journal on a computer screen, text or photos against a white background. It is something that can exist on a page without losing much of his impact.
I would like to have my work published here as it seems professional and filled with some decent work. I feel like I would be in good, if not superior, company.
